#5b1e72 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5b1e72 is composed of 35.7% red, 11.8%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.2% cyan, 73.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 283.6 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 28.2%. #5b1e72 color hex could be obtained by blending #b63ce4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#5b1e72 color description : Very dark violet.

#5b1e72 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5b1e72 has RGB values of R:91, G:30,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 5971570.

Shades and Tints of #5b1e72

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040105 is the darkest color, while #faf5f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#5b1e72

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#49454b is the less saturated color, while #68028e is the most saturated one.
